Transaction 511cd5f3d2d71f697336c6463283b006502404550217afe3a90b2b3254262ea1
1 Input
2 Outputs
- 511cd5f3d2d71f697336c6463283b006502404550217afe3a90b2b3254262ea1:0
- 511cd5f3d2d71f697336c6463283b006502404550217afe3a90b2b3254262ea1:1
value 13900000
address 13P8Dpwj78EA7v7rtiDWTjdVVNEf2eEMqY
value 594260266
address 12fTyDMHjmLNNX7ZjpdeExTAeHZGs31Eqj